Output 554f44faad5120ff0c4b240f0aee8aaea21064d2f5a290c97d4a4950be303fea:1

value
17395685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3758ff099999ef5f3937ec741c86d3feecf4b OP_EQUAL
address
3BMEXXfx11Fpx9oYZUw6ELULJpJPSCQLEV
transaction
554f44faad5120ff0c4b240f0aee8aaea21064d2f5a290c97d4a4950be303fea
confirmations
267434
spent
true